What Are Road Sweeper Machines?

Road sweeper machines are specialized vehicles equipped with sweeping and collecting mechanisms designed to remove litter, dust, and debris from roads, parking lots, and other surfaces. They come in various designs and capabilities, suited for different cleaning tasks. Road sweepers can be classified into two main types:

  • Mechanical Sweepers: Utilizing brushes that sweep debris into a collection hopper, these machines are effective on larger particles.
  • Suction Sweepers: Using a combination of high-velocity air and a vacuum, these machines are excellent for picking up finer particles, including dust and small debris.

Different Types of Road Sweepers

Understanding the different types of road sweeper machines available on the market helps municipalities and contractors choose the right equipment for their specific needs. Here are the most common types:

1. Ride-On Road Sweepers

These machines are operated by an onboard driver. They are typically larger and more powerful and are ideal for sweeping large areas such as highways and parking lots.

2. Walk-Behind Sweepers

Smaller and more compact, these sweepers are operated manually. They are suited for smaller spaces like sidewalks, driveways, and smaller parking lots.

3. Truck-Mounted Sweepers

These are heavy-duty machines mounted on trucks, perfect for large municipalities. They combine efficiency with high capacity and are capable of cleaning expansive areas.

4. Electric Sweepers

With the shift toward green technology, electric road sweepers are gaining popularity. They offer quiet operation and zero emissions, making them an excellent choice for urban environments.

5. Vacuum Sweepers

These machines use powerful vacuums to suck up debris and are particularly good for fine dust and small particles, making them perfect for sensitive environments.

Maintenance of Road Sweeper Machines

To ensure the longevity and efficiency of road sweeper machines, regular maintenance is essential. Key maintenance practices include:

  • Regular Cleaning: Keeping the exterior and interior of the machine clean prevents dirt buildup, maintaining its functionality.
  • Mechanical Inspections: Routine checks on the engine, brushes, and collection hoppers ensure all components are in working order.
  • Fluid Checks: Regularly checking and replacing oil, coolant, and hydraulic fluid is crucial for optimal performance.
  • Tire Maintenance: Inspect tires for wear and tear, ensuring that the sweeper remains safe and operational.
  • Battery Management: For electric models, ensure batteries are charged and properly maintained to extend their life cycle.
